Output e72fd3a73356d653061a8f31bcd51f87369bac675d7601f13be1e5d1a8568d3a:0

value
46388
script pubkey
OP_0 OP_PUSHBYTES_20 a44478abc99115d06a67552f4c918d331245c926
address
bc1q53z8327fjy2aq6n825h5eyvdxvfytjfxhyelcy
transaction
e72fd3a73356d653061a8f31bcd51f87369bac675d7601f13be1e5d1a8568d3a
confirmations
336106
spent
true